国产自研引擎的技术实现与性能优化解析
国产自研引擎近年来在数据中台、数字孪生和数字可视化等领域取得了显著进展。这些引擎不仅在技术实现上具备创新性,还在性能优化方面表现出色,为企业提供了高效、可靠的技术解决方案。本文将深入解析国产自研引擎的技术实现与性能优化,为企业用户和技术爱好者提供详细的技术指南。
国产自研引擎是指完全自主研发的软件引擎,广泛应用于数据处理、图形渲染、物理仿真等领域。这些引擎的核心优势在于其灵活性、可定制性和安全性,能够满足企业对高性能和高可靠性的需求。
引擎是软件开发中的核心模块,负责处理数据、渲染图形、管理资源等任务。国产自研引擎主要分为以下几类:
国产自研引擎的优势在于其完全自主可控,能够避免依赖第三方技术,提升企业的技术安全性和竞争力。此外,这些引擎可以根据企业需求进行深度定制,满足特定场景的应用需求。
国产自研引擎的技术实现涉及多个模块,包括渲染引擎、脚本引擎、数据处理引擎和编译器/解释器等。每个模块都有其独特的技术实现方式。
渲染引擎是国产自研引擎的核心模块之一,负责将数据转换为可视化的图形输出。其技术实现主要包括以下步骤:
脚本引擎用于执行脚本语言,如JavaScript、Python等。其技术实现主要包括:
数据处理引擎用于对数据进行清洗、转换和分析。其技术实现主要包括:
编译器/解释器用于将高级语言代码转换为机器码或中间代码。其技术实现主要包括:
性能优化是国产自研引擎开发中的重要环节,直接影响引擎的运行效率和用户体验。以下是一些常见的性能优化方法。
渲染性能优化是提升引擎性能的关键。以下是一些常用的渲染性能优化方法:
资源管理优化是提升引擎性能的重要手段。以下是一些常用的资源管理优化方法:
数据处理效率优化是提升引擎性能的重要手段。以下是一些常用的数据处理效率优化方法:
引擎架构优化是提升引擎性能的重要手段。以下是一些常用的游戏引擎架构优化方法:
数据中台是企业数字化转型的重要基础设施,国产自研引擎在数据中台中的应用主要体现在数据处理和可视化方面。
数据处理引擎在数据中台中的应用主要体现在数据清洗、转换和分析方面。通过数据处理引擎,企业可以高效地处理海量数据,提取有价值的信息。
可视化引擎在数据中台中的应用主要体现在数据可视化方面。通过可视化引擎,企业可以将复杂的数据以直观的方式呈现,帮助决策者快速理解数据。
数字孪生是实现物理世界与数字世界融合的重要技术,国产自研引擎在数字孪生中的应用主要体现在实时渲染和物理仿真方面。
实时渲染引擎在数字孪生中的应用主要体现在实时渲染方面。通过实时渲染引擎,企业可以实现高精度的实时渲染,提升数字孪生的沉浸感。
物理仿真引擎在数字孪生中的应用主要体现在物理仿真方面。通过物理仿真引擎,企业可以模拟物理世界中的运动和交互,提升数字孪生的准确性。
数字可视化是将数据以图形化方式呈现的重要技术,国产自研引擎在数字可视化中的应用主要体现在交互设计和动态更新方面。
交互设计引擎在数字可视化中的应用主要体现在交互设计方面。通过交互设计引擎,企业可以实现丰富的交互功能,提升用户体验。
动态更新引擎在数字可视化中的应用主要体现在动态更新方面。通过动态更新引擎,企业可以实现数据的实时更新,提升数字可视化的实时性。
申请试用&https://www.dtstack.com/?src=bbs
国产自研引擎在数据中台、数字孪生和数字可视化等领域取得了显著进展。这些引擎不仅在技术实现上具备创新性,还在性能优化方面表现出色,为企业提供了高效、可靠的技术解决方案。如果您对国产自研引擎感兴趣,可以申请试用,体验其强大的功能和性能。
申请试用&https://www.dtstack.com/?src=bbs
申请试用&https://www.dtstack.com/?src=bbs
通过本文的详细解析,相信您对国产自研引擎的技术实现与性能优化有了更深入的了解。如果您有任何疑问或需要进一步的技术支持,欢迎随时联系我们。
申请试用&下载资料